1.Structural Transformation of the Korean Healthcare System to Protect National Health Rights:From the Perspective of Consumers and Primary Care
Mihwa YOO ; Hee Gyung KANG ; Jae-Heon KANG ; Minjoung KO ; Jong Myoung KIM ; Kunhee PARK ; Serng Bai PAK ; Chiwon SEO ; Junghee AHN ; Juhwan OH ; Eunyoung CHO ; Eun Jin HA
Korean Journal of Family Practice 2026;16(1):9-12
The South Korean healthcare system has achieved rapid quantitative growth; however, it continues to face critical challenges in ensuring the fundamental right to health of its citizens. From the perspective of healthcare consumers and civil society, this article identifies structural problems such as imbalances in medical accessibility, instability in essential and emergency care, and the limited participation of consumers in healthcare policy-making. Although the constitution stipulates the state’s responsibility to protect public health, current healthcare policies often prioritize administrative efficiency and provider-centered interests over patient experiences and health outcomes. In particular, this article argues that these challenges are closely related to the inadequate functioning of an accountable healthcare management framework. Structural failures in essential care, workforce shortages, and regional disparities are insufficiently monitored and addressed at the system level, resulting in responsibilities being blurred or shifted to individual healthcare providers. Consequently, the risks and burdens arising from systemic weaknesses are ultimately borne by citizens. To address these issues, this article emphasizes two major shifts. First, meaningful consumer participation must be institutionalized within healthcare governance to strengthen accountability, transparency, and responsiveness. Second, family medicine and primary care should be reinforced as the cornerstone of a sustainable, community-based healthcare system that ensures continuity of care, prevention, and chronic disease management. Re-establishing the healthcare system based on the right to health is not merely a technical adjustment, but a structural transformation toward a responsible and accountable system in which the state clearly assumes responsibility for monitoring, learning, and corrective action.
2.Case report of functional medicine: functional hypoglycemia with continuous glucose monitoring and adrenal fatigue
Journal of Korean Institute for Functional Medicine 2025;8(1):112-125
Functional hypoglycemia has not yet been clearly defined, however, it is generally understood as a condition in which hypoglycemic symptoms occur, predominantly postprandially, in the absence of glucose-related diseases or identifiable organic causes, such as diabetes mellitus, alcoholism, insulinoma, or insulin autoantibodies. The management for functional hypoglycemia is also not well established. Dietary modification, such as eating small, frequent meals, reducing carbohydrate intake, and increasing dietary fiber, is important, and regular physical activity is also useful. But other treatment options are limited and well not established. From a functional medicine perspective, functional hypoglycemia is thought to be associated with impaired insulin counter-regulatory response, particularly involving adrenal hormone function. A functional medical approach may be beneficial in managing patients with diminished adrenal capacity. In this context, we aim to explore the functional medicine-based diagnostic and therapeutic approach to functional hypoglycemia by presenting a case in which a suspected functional hypoglycemia was evaluated using continuous glucose monitoring and showed clinical improvement following dietary interventions and adrenal support therapy.
3.Protective Effect of Human Placenta Hydrolysates on Lidocaine Induced-Cytotoxicity in Human Chondrocyte
Kyeongsoo JEONG ; Jeong-Ju LIM ; Dong Pill CHO ; Jae-Won KIM ; Tae Hwan CHO
The Journal of the Korean Orthopaedic Association 2025;60(3):167-174
Purpose:
Lidocaine, a type of local anesthetic, is used widely to suppress pain during intra-articular injections, but many studies have suggested that lidocaine is toxic to the articular cartilage. This study examined the biological changes that occur when chondrocytes are exposed to lidocaine to determine the protective effect of human placenta hydrolysate (HPH) on chondrocytes.
Materials and Methods:
SW1353 cells, human-derived chondrocytes, were treated with lidocaine and HPH to confirm the changes in cell viability, production of reactive oxygen species, and MMP13 and BNIP3 gene expression levels. In addition, the radical scavenging ability of HPH was evaluated using an ABTS assay.
Results:
After treating the cells with the test substance for 72 hours, the cell viability increased by up to 28% in the HPH/lidocaine-treated group compared to the lidocaine-treated group. The level of reactive oxygen species, which was increased by lidocaine, was lower in the group treated with HPH/lidocaine. In addition, the expression levels of the MMP13 gene, which damages cartilage tissue, and the BNIP3 gene, which is involved in mitophagy, were also 21% and 69% lower, respectively, in the HPH/lidocaine-treated group than in the lidocainetreated group.
Conclusion
HPH may alleviate the side effects of an intra-articular injection of lidocaine by suppressing cell death, suppressing free radicals, and alleviating intracellular mitochondrial damage.
4.Functional medical integration for chronic migraine management
Journal of Korean Institute for Functional Medicine 2024;7(1):17-25
Chronic migraine, affecting approximately 2% of the global population, markedly diminishes quality of life and imposes significant societal costs, surpassing the impacts of episodic migraine. Conventional medical treatments leave about 30% of patients with persistent chronic migraine, some of whom fluctuate between episodic and chronic migraine states. A holistic, functional medicine approach may provide supplementary benefits for these individuals. Clinical imbalances often identified in chronic migraine patients—such as mitochondrial dysfunction, oxidative stress, gut microbiota dysbiosis, leaky gut syndrome, food intolerance, histamine syndrome, vitamin D deficiency, and autonomic nervous system imbalances—can be detected through specific functional medical assessments, including urine organic acid profiles, hair tissue mineral analysis, hydrogen breath tests, comprehensive blood tests, and heart rate variability tests. Integrative functional medical interventions, encompassing lifestyle modifications, oral and intravenous nutrition therapies, and the comprehensive 5R program (remove, replace, reinoculate, repair, rebalance) for gut health, could offer therapeutic benefits. This review delves into the functional medicine paradigm and its potential role in managing chronic migraine.
5.Case report of functional medicine a case of long COVID with adrenal fatigue
Journal of Korean Institute for Functional Medicine 2024;7(1):68-77
Long COVID, also known as post-acute sequelae of SARS-CoV-2 infection or post-acute COVID-19 syndrome, refers to a range of symptoms and complications that persist more than four weeks after diagnosis. Typical symptoms include fatigue, headache, anosmia, ageusia, chronic cough, shortness of breath, impaired concentration and memory (brain fog), sleep disturbances, depression, anxiety, and hair loss. The incidence of long COVID varies according to the data, but it has been reported in approximately 20-60% of acute COVID-19 patients. However, despite its high incidence and significant medical and societal burden, there is currently no clear definition or objective diagnostic criteria for long COVID. Its diagnosis and treatment options are also limited and not established due to insufficient evidence. Nevertheless, a functional medicine approach, especially focused on adrenal functional and adrenal fatigue, can help long COVID patients. Relevant blood tests and urinary organic acid profile can be utilized, and lifestyle modification, oral or intravenous nutrition therapies can be implemented. In this article, we report a clinical case of long COVID with adrenal fatigue, demonstrating significant improvement after functional medical approach and management.
6.Case report of functional medicine: improvement of alopecia areata after 5R program
Journal of Korean Institute for Functional Medicine 2024;7(1):78-86
The gut and skin health are closely related, defined as gut-skin axis. In particular, gut microbiome has been revealed as major factor of gut-skin axis (gut-microbiome-skin axis). Psoriasis, atopic dermatitis, acne vulgaris, rosacea, hidradenitis suppurativa, and alopecia areata are elucidated as skin disease related with gut microbiome. However, in most clinical situations, skin diseases did not show significant improvement with probiotics alone. Because, various factors are involved in gut-microbiome-skin axis, including intestinal permeability, detoxification, brain function, neurotransmitter, immune and inflammatory imbalance. Also, probiotics alone cannot induce significant changes in whole intestinal microbiome. Functional medicine suggests 5R program (or 5R treatment) as a method to restore overall intestinal health. 5R program consists of five steps: remove, replace, reinoculate, repair, and rebalance. In the remove stage, antibiotics such as rifaximin are used to reduce intestinal microorganisms. In the replace stage, digestive enzyme or supplements for gastric or bile acid secretion are used. In the reinoculate stage, probiotics and prebiotics are supplied. In the repair stage, the intestinal barrier is restored by glutamine, lactoferrin or zinc. In the rebalance stage, lifestyle modification is emphasized to maintain balance between gut and whole-body health. It is thought that 5R program is more effective than probiotics alone in skin diseases, but the evidence is still lacking. We present a case of alopecia areata who did not response to conventional treatment but cured after 5R program and nutrition therapy, to explore the effectiveness of 5R program on skin disease with literature review.

8.Current evidence and clinical applications of placental extracts
Journal of Korean Institute for Functional Medicine 2024;7(2):19-30
The placenta, a tissue unique to mammals including humans, plays multiple essential roles during pregnancy, facilitating nutrient supply, metabolism, immune modulation, and hormone regulation between the fetus and mouther. Historically, medical use of the placenta dates back to antiquity, with Hippocrates reportedly using it as a therapeutic agent, and traditional Asian medical textbooks such as Bencao Gangmu in China and Donguibogam in Korea also documenting its medicinal properties. In modern medicine, Soviet ophthalmologist Vladimir Filatov utilized placenta in disease treatment in the 1930s, and in the 1950s, placental preparations began pharmaceutical production in Japan. Recently, two injectable placental products, human placental extracts and human placental hydrolysates (HPH), are approved for menopausal symptom relief and liver function improvement in South Korea (though in clinical practice or research area, HPH often described simply as placental extracts). Current interest in anti-aging, menopause, regeneration, and detoxification has increased utilization and research on these placental products, although well-designed studies and evidence remain limited. This article aims to review the current medical evidence and clinical application of placental extracts, especially with a focus on HPH drawing from the authors' extensive clinical experience.
9.Application of tenotomy on Korean native cattle (Hanwoo) with spastic paresis symptoms in the field
Younghye RO ; Woojae CHOI ; Leegon HONG ; Kyunghyun MIN ; Inkwang RYU ; Danil KIM
Journal of Veterinary Science 2023;24(3):e45-
Bovine spastic paresis (BSP) is a neuromuscular disorder characterized by hypertension and stiffness of hindlimb. Two Korean native cattle (Hanwoo) calves developed BSP or BSP-like symptoms, and a tenotomy of superficial tendon of medial head and deep tendon of lateral head of gastrocnemius muscle was performed for treatment. A cast was applied postoperatively to prevent muscle rupture and was removed three weeks later. The prognosis was evaluated at 3 weeks, 6 and 18 months postoperatively. Neither calf showed any other postoperative sequelae. This is the first case study to report the diagnosis, treatment, and prognosis of BSP in Hanwoo.
10.Setting Priority Criteria for Classification of Self-Testing In Vitro Diagnostic Medical Devices Using Analytic Hierarchy Process Technique
Seol-Ihn KIM ; Do-Yun PYEON ; Yong-Ik JEONG ; Jahyun CHO ; Gaya NOH ; Green BAE ; Hye-Young KWON
Health Policy and Management 2023;33(2):173-184
Background:
The coronavirus disease 2019 pandemic has been challenging the healthcare service, i.e., the vitalization of the point of care accompanying self-testing in vitro diagnostic medical devices (IVDs). This study aims to suggest priority criteria to classify self-testing IVDs using the analytic hierarchy process technique.
Methods:
Two dimensions of the characteristics embedded in the IVDs and the diseases to be diagnosed with self-testing IVDs were parallelly considered and independently investigated. In addition, three expert panels consisting of laboratory medical doctors (n=11), clinicians (n=10), and citizens (n=11) who have an interest in the selection of self-testing IVDs were asked to answer to questionnaires. Priorities were derived and compared among each expert panel.
Results:
First of all, ease of specimen collection (0.241), urgency of the situation (0.224), and simplicity of device operation (0.214) were found to be the most important criteria in light of the functional characteristics of self-testing IVDs. Medical doctors valued the ease of specimen collection, but the citizen’s panel valued self-management of the disease more. Second, considering the characteristics of the diseases, the priority criteria were shown in the order of prevalence of diseases (0.421), fatality of disease (0.378), and disease with stigma (0.201). Third, medical doctors responded that self-testing IVDs were more than twice as suitable for non-communicable diseases as compared to communicable diseases (0.688 vs. 0.312), but the citizen’s group responded that self-testing IVDs were slightly more suitable for infectious diseases (0.511 vs. 0.489).
Conclusion
Our findings suggested that self-testing IVDs could be primarily classified as the items for diagnosis of non-communicable diseases for the purpose of self-management with easy specimen collection and simple operation of devices, taking into account the urgency of the situation as well as prevalence and fatality of the disease.
